Frequently Asked Questions

What is LOINC code 100034-8?

LOINC code 100034-8 identifies "Provider of automated external defibrillator use". The type of person (e.g. lay person, physician, paramedic) who applied the AED to the patient.

What does 100034-8 measure?

This code measures Provider of automated external defibrillator use in ^Patient. It belongs to the TRAUMA class in the LOINC classification.

What is LOINC?

LOINC (Logical Observation Identifiers Names and Codes) is a universal standard for identifying laboratory and clinical observations. It is maintained by the Regenstrief Institute and used worldwide for health data exchange.
